Lauding the troops involved in surgical strikes on the launch pads across the LoC, Defence Minister Manohar Parikkar said on Saturday that “we will give a befitting reply to those who try to harm us.”

Comparing the power of the Army to that of Hanuman, Mr. Parikkar said, “I only made the Army aware of the powers it already possessed and it succeeded. On Modi ji’s instructions the Army did a brilliant job. On behalf of the country, I congratulate the troops [involved in the surgical strikes].”

Parikkar, who was addressing a gathering in Uttarakhand’s Peethsain in Pauri district, said that Pakistan was in an “unconscious” state after the surgical strikes. It was, therefore, denying that the strikes happened.

Speaking on the motive of the strikes, Mr. Parikkar, in his first public statement after the surgical strikes said, “We don’t want to capture any country. Like Lord Rama conquered Lanka and gave it to Vibhishan. We did the same in the Bangladesh operation .”

The Defence Minister added that if Pakistan continued with such conspiracies, India will not hesitate to give them a befitting reply again.
On Thursday India had carried out surgical strikes on seven terror launch pads along the LoC with the Army inflicting significant casualties on terrorists preparing to infiltrate from PoK, marking a clear departure from its response to cross-border terrorism in the past. The strikes were conducted 10 days after the terrorist attack on an Army camp in Uri that left 20 soldiers dead.
